Tien Giang attracts 80,644 tourists during 3-day holiday

(ABO) Tien Giang welcomed a total of 80,644 tourists during the 3-day holiday (from April 30 to May 2, 2025), an increase of 129.7% over the same period last year; of which, international visitors reached 6,786, an increase of 27.6%. Total tourism revenue is estimated at 49 billion VND, a sharp increase of 155.3% over the same period.

Tourists coming to Tien Giang during the 3-day holiday (from April 30 to May 2, 2025) increased by 129.7% over the same period last year.

According to the assessment of the Tourism Management Department under the Department of Culture, Sports and Tourism of Tien Giang province, the province has prominent destinations such as Hung Vuong Square, Thoi Son Islet, Dong Tam Snake Farm, Lien Hoa Pagoda... attracting a large number of tourists, reaching 59,758 arrivals (including 5,773 international arrivals).

The western region of the province, including Tan Phong Islet, Dong Hoa Hiep Ancient Village, Truc Lam Chanh Giac Zen Monastery and Dong Thap Muoi Biosphere Reserve, welcomed 7,439 visitors, including 1,013 international visitors.

Meanwhile, the eastern region of the province with destinations such as Tan Thanh Beach Tourist Area, Sau Hoi Apple Garden and historical and cultural relics recorded 13,447 visitors, mainly domestic visitors.

Overall, this positive result shows the growing attraction of Tien Giang tourism; at the same time, it reflects the locality's efforts in improving service quality and promoting its image to domestic and foreign tourists.
